Percentage of teachers in lower secondary education who are female in Slovenia
Slovenia: Percentage of teachers in lower secondary education who are female was 79.3% in 2016. ▬ Flat
Percentage of teachers in lower secondary education who are female in Slovenia, 1996–2016
Source: UNESCO Institute for Statistics. Measured in %.
Analysis
In 2016, percentage of teachers in lower secondary education who are female in Slovenia stood at 79.3%.
That represents a change of down 0.1% on the previous year and up 0.9% over ten years.
Over the whole period, percentage of teachers in lower secondary education who are female in Slovenia peaked at 79.5% in 2014 and was at its lowest, 74.6%, in 2001.
Slovenia ranks 11th of 156 countries on this measure, in the top 10%.

Slovenia compared with similar countries
- Slovenia's 79.3% is above the median for high income countries, which is 68.1%, 1.2× the median. (62 countries reporting)
- Slovenia's 79.3% is above the median for Europe & Central Asia, which is 72.1%, 1.1× the median. (45 countries reporting)
